
Whether you like or dislike going to office parties is irrelevant because this is a function that everyone should attend unless an emergency or illness keeps them from attending. Remember, the office party is an extension of your job and making an appearance does say that you value your job enough to attend. You don’t have to arrive first and you don’t have to stay the entire time. Arrive early enough for initial greetings and small talk before everyone starts to eat. Be sure to find the host, usually the boss and thank him or her and engage in the customary chit chat, however be considerate, don’t monopolize the host’s time. Don’t go overboard with trying to make a good impression and do the opposite. Be yourself, mingle and introduce yourself to people that you have not met. If you don’t like socializing, grin and bare it and do it anyway. You’ll only have to do it for a couple of hours.
